Where do I deliver legal documents (legal notices, subpoenas, etc.) to the University?

All legal documents should be delivered to the OGC at GM-930. For your convenience and ease of reference, a campus map is available here.

Kindly note that the OGC will not accept legal documents on behalf of students. Additionally, the OGC will not accept legal documents on behalf of employees if these documents do not relate to University matters.

I am a University employee or student and I have a personal legal question. Can I contact the Office of the General Counsel?

The OGC does not provide legal advice regarding the personal issues of University employees or students.
